Report: Michael Chandler vs Patricio Pitbull to headline Bellator 221 in Chicago

Bellator MMA is making their return to Chicago in a big way. According to Ariel Helwani of ESPN, Bellator 221 will be headline by a champion vs champion matchup when rivals Patricio “Pitbull” Freire and Michael Chandler will fight in the main event that takes place on Saturday, May 11, at AllState Arena in Rosemont, Illinois.

The featherweight champion Freire will be jumping up to lightweight where Michael Chandler’s 155-pound title will be on the line. According to Helwani, an official announcement is expected to come from Bellator later this weekend. “Pitbull” will have an opportunity to become the promotion’s second two-weight champion after Ryan Bader became the first ever two-weight champion when he won the Heavyweight Grand Prix and became heavyweight champion in his victory over Fedor Emelianenko at Bellator 214 last month.

The rivalry between the Freire and Chandler has been brewing for years after Chandler knocked out Patricky Freire at Bellator 157. Following the win, Patricio and Chandler were involved in a post-fight altercation which has led to the last few years of trash talk between the two, especially on social media.

Michael Chandler reclaimed his Bellator lightweight title when he defeated Brent Primus by unanimous decision at Bellator 212 this past December. Chandler lost the title to Primus at Bellator 180 then would go on to bounce back with a three-fight winning streak that was capped off by the rematch victory over Primus. Patricio Freire also finds himself on a three-fight win streak coming into this scheduled matchup with Chandler, his most recent victory was a title defense against Emmanuel Sanchez at Bellator 209.

Also included in the Helwani’s report is the return of several big names under the Bellator promotion. According to Helwani, the winner of this weekend’s Paul Daley vs Michael Venom Page fight will take on Douglas Lima, while former two-time featherweight champion Pat Curran will take on A.J. McKee in a rebooking of their fight that had been scheduled for Bellator 205 last September.

Former WWE star Jake Hager who successfully made his Bellator debut this past January at Bellator 214, is scheduled to get his second fight at Bellator 221 but an opponent has not yet been finalized according to the ESPN report.
